Been meaning to post this as soon as I got it, but then I got caught up in other things and I forgot about it.
I bought a new HDTV about 2-3 weeks ago. It's not really all that big at 32" but I'm happy with it nevertheless. It's an LG 32lg30 at 720p. I was looking at a Sony Bravia as well but that was 200 bucks more, and I'm perfectly satisfied with this one. It actually has a lot of features that you'd only get with the more expensive television sets: plenty of connectors and a shitload of options. I really love that each input can have 7 distinct profiles for sound and visual settings. It's kinda overkill since I can't think of any situation where I would need 7 different profiles for an input.
